gpt4 book ai didi

angular - 如何禁用 ionic 4 中的侧边菜单?

转载 作者:太空狗 更新时间:2023-10-29 17:30:55 24 4
gpt4 key购买 nike

我正在为 ionic 3 应用程序使用 this.menuCtrl.swipeEnable(false);。这适用于禁用侧边菜单。但是,它不适用于 ionic 4!下面是我的 ionic 4 代码示例:

login.page.ts

constructor(public loginService: LoginService, private router: Router, public menuCtrl: MenuController) {
this.menuCtrl.swipeEnable(false);
}

app.component.html

<ion-app>
<ion-split-pane>
<ion-menu type="push">
<ion-header>
<ion-toolbar color="success">
<ion-title>Menu</ion-title>
</ion-toolbar>
</ion-header>
<ion-content>
<ion-list>
<ion-menu-toggle auto-hide="false" *ngFor="let p of appPages">
<ion-item [routerDirection]="'root'" [routerLink]="[p.url]">
<ion-icon slot="start" [name]="p.icon"></ion-icon>
<ion-label>
{{p.title}}
</ion-label>
</ion-item>
</ion-menu-toggle>
</ion-list>
</ion-content>
</ion-menu>
<ion-router-outlet main></ion-router-outlet>
</ion-split-pane>
</ion-app>

最佳答案

this.menuCtrl.enable(false);

这也适用于构造函数。我在 ionic v4 - beta.2 项目中使用它,它工作正常。

此外,我看到您将 ionicangular 一起使用,因此您也可以使用 OnInit 生命周期 Hook 。

关于angular - 如何禁用 ionic 4 中的侧边菜单?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51802594/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com